Welcome to Sant’Ana Church, dating back to the 18th century. Just like its neighbour, it blends traditional Algarve elements—such as white limewashed walls—with Baroque features, particularly in its façade. It’s one of Albufeira’s biggest churches and its traditional Algarvian design captivates every visitor, making it a must-see landmark! Inside, the main chapel is adorned with a beautiful polychrome wooden altarpiece in a refined Rococo style.
